4473942f46
SPKD base bdev might be part of multiple vbdevs. The same is true in reverse direction. So consider folowing scenario: bdev3 bdev4 bdev5 | | | +-+--+ + +--+--+ / \ | / \ bdev0 bdev1 bdev2 In current implementation bdev0/1/2 will apear as base base for bdev3/4/5 which is obviously wrong. This patch try to address this issue. Change-Id: Ic99c13c8656ceb597aba7e41ccb2fa8090b4f13b Signed-off-by: Pawel Wodkowski <pawelx.wodkowski@intel.com> Reviewed-on: https://review.gerrithub.io/405104 Reviewed-by: Shuhei Matsumoto <shuhei.matsumoto.xt@hitachi.com> Reviewed-by: Dariusz Stojaczyk <dariuszx.stojaczyk@intel.com> Tested-by: SPDK Automated Test System <sys_sgsw@intel.com> Reviewed-by: Daniel Verkamp <daniel.verkamp@intel.com> |
||
---|---|---|
.. | ||
bdev | ||
blob | ||
blobfs | ||
event | ||
ioat | ||
iscsi | ||
json | ||
jsonrpc | ||
log | ||
lvol | ||
net | ||
nvme | ||
nvmf | ||
scsi | ||
util | ||
vhost | ||
json_mock.c | ||
Makefile |